Address: 2700 17 Mile Drive, Pebble Beach CA 93953 (north end of the 17 Mile Drive corridor, on the Pacific dunes, 3.5 miles north of The Lodge at Pebble Beach)
Operator: Pebble Beach Company (sister to The Lodge at Pebble Beach + Casa Palmero)
Opened: 1987 (the newer of the Pebble Beach Company resorts; designed contemporaneously with The Links at Spanish Bay golf course)
Rooms: 269 rooms + suites across multi-story buildings on the coastal-dunes property (many with golf course or partial ocean view, in-room fireplaces)
Setting: Pacific coastal dunes — native dune vegetation, ocean breezes, traditional Scottish links-golf landscape character
The Links at Spanish Bay (1987): Tom Watson + Robert Trent Jones Jr. + Sandy Tatum design. True links-style course with native dune vegetation, walking-only ethos. Routinely rated among the top resort courses in the U.S.
Roy's at Pebble Beach: Roy Yamaguchi's Hawaiian-fusion signature restaurant — the Inn's dinner anchor with golf-course and Pacific-ocean views
Peppoli at Pebble Beach: Italian-Tuscan dining with Marchesi Antinori wine focus
STICKS: the casual lobby grill (breakfast + lunch + casual dinner with golf-course terrace seating)
The sunset bagpiper: nightly kilted bagpiper at the fire pit overlooking the 18th green of The Links at Spanish Bay (timing seasonal). The resort's signature tradition since 1987
The Spa at Pebble Beach: resort spa with cross-property guest access

Every evening at sunset a kilted bagpiper plays from the dunes overlooking the 18th green of The Links at Spanish Bay, while guests gather at Traders fireside lounge with cocktails. Instituted at the 1987 opening, paying tribute to the Scottish links-golf heritage that the course design (Watson + Jones + Tatum) intentionally evokes. Resort guests have transferable access across all four Pebble Beach Company courses: The Links at Spanish Bay (1987 Watson/Jones/Tatum links), Pebble Beach Golf Links (1919 iconic clifftop), Spyglass Hill (Robert Trent Jones Sr. 1966 forest + ocean transitions), Del Monte (1897, oldest course west of the Mississippi in continuous play). Spanish Bay sits at the northern end of 17 Mile Drive. Iconic stops: Lone Cypress (the ~250-year-old unofficial Pebble Beach symbol), Bird Rock, Seal Rock, Spanish Bay Beach (at the resort), Cypress Point Lookout, Pescadero Point, descent to The Lodge. 90-minute scenic chauffeur sweep with photo stops, often paired with lunch at The Bench or Roy's return to Spanish Bay.
